Engaging in yoga has become a common way to gain flexibility, strength, and mental awareness. For yoga newcomers, initiating a yoga journey can be both invigorating and intimidating with the wide range of poses to become familiar with. To help you ease into it, here are five essential yoga poses that are great for yoga beginners.



1. Tadasana

Standing Mountain Pose is the base of all standing postures. Though it may seem basic, it’s all about balance and positioning. Stand with your feet slightly apart or just apart, arms at your sides, and shift your weight in balance across both feet. Activate your thighs, lift your chest, and press your shoulders down. This pose helps better your posture and establishes a sense of grounding.

2. Downward Dog

Adho Mukha Svanasana is a key element in many yoga sequences. Start on your hands and knees, then lift your waist toward the ceiling, lifting your legs and developing an inverted “V” shape with your body. Keep your hands at shoulder width and feet apart at hip distance. This pose lengthens the hamstrings, shoulders, and calves while firming up the arms and legs. It also helps to quiet the mind and promote relaxation.

3. Warrior I

First Warrior Pose is a energizing pose that enhances power in the legs and core. Begin in a standing pose, take a backward step, and bend the leading knee while keeping the back leg firm. Lift your arms overhead, palms facing each other. This pose encourages balance, boosts endurance, and opens up the chest and hips.

4. Pose of the Child

This pose is a resting pose that provides a easy stretch for the back, hips, and thighs. Start on your knees and hands, then sit back on your heels and move your arms forward, pressing your forehead to the mat. It’s perfect for recovering between difficult poses or quieting your thoughts when feeling stressed.

5. Tree Balance Pose

This pose is a amazing balance pose for newcomers. Stand tall, balance your weight onto one foot, and place the sole of your other foot on your thigh or calf (avoid the knee). Join your hands in front of your chest or reach them overhead. This pose tones your legs, enhances stability, and boosts mindfulness.
